Menu
Home > Blog
The Dyalog Blog
Stay updated with the latest from Dyalog Ltd. Our blog covers industry insights, company news, innovative projects, and more.
Although run-time performance is rarely the most important reason for selecting APL, good performance often becomes important during the lifetime of an application (especially if it is successful and, therefore, has to deal with growing data volumes and numbers of users). Array-oriented programming naturally encourages Subject Matter Experts to use dense and pointer-free structures, which … Read
- In: CTO, Dyalog '23, Events, Videos
An increasing number of APL systems serve business logic as services, in addition to providing a user interface. Some recent APL applications have no user interface at all, and are only available as services. For this reason, Dyalog’s web service framework, Jarvis, features prominently in Brian Becker’s overview of the current state of tool development … Read
- In: CTO, Dyalog '23, Events, Videos
This week, the focus is on the use of tools and interfaces in applications. Mark Wolfson from BIG integrates data from 1,000 retailers to provide business intelligence to both the retailers and manufacturers. Over the last couple of years, Mark has migrated his application from IBM APL2 to Dyalog APL. He tells the story of … Read
- In: CTO, Dyalog '23, Events, Videos
I am always thrilled to hear from people who have been able to use APL to gain insight into difficult subjects, or use APL to pass knowledge on to others. A truly fascinating and surprising example of this at Dyalog ’23 was the talk titled “quAPL – A Quantum Computing Library in APL”, in which … Read
- In: CTO, Dyalog '23, Events, Videos
This week’s collection consists of presentations by members of the development team, and concentrates on language features and development tools that the developers are currently designing or already implementing. Many of these features are likely to be in version 20.0 of Dyalog, which we plan to release in early 2025, about a year after version … Read
- In: CTO, Dyalog '23, Events, Videos
In pursuit of his dream to contribute to the development of a programming language professionally, Aarush started cold emailing companies that worked on them (there aren’t a lot, but a lot). One of the companies he contacted was Dyalog Ltd. Aarush initially joined us in January 2023 as a contractor, focusing on testing the primitives … Read
- In: Team Dyalog, Welcome
Categories
- Algorithms (24)
- APL Language (63)
- APL Problem Solving Competition (18)
- APL Seeds (3)
- Community (22)
- CTO (60)
- CXO (11)
- Dyalog '14 (11)
- Dyalog '15 (14)
- Dyalog '16 (13)
- Dyalog '17 (2)
- Dyalog '18 (9)
- Dyalog '19 (16)
- Dyalog '20 (2)
- Dyalog '22 (5)
- Dyalog '23 (13)
- Dyalog '24 (6)
- Dyalog on the road… (8)
- DYNA (1)
- Events (88)
- Implementation (8)
- MiServer (5)
- Musings (15)
- Raspberry Pi (20)
- Recreational (12)
- Robots (13)
- SharpPlot (3)
- Team Dyalog (32)
- Tips & Tricks (11)
- Tools (10)
- Use Cases (3)
- Videos (36)
- Welcome (19)
- Windows (3)